Table of Contents:
  • Introduction : a homesteader's guide to the red planet?
  • A preamble on space myths
  • Part I: Caring for the spacefaring. Suffocation, bone loss, and flying pigs : the science of space physiology ; Space sex and consequences thereof ; Spacefarer psychology : in which the only thing we're sure of is that astronauts are liars ; Nota bene : rocketry goes to the movies, or, space capitalism in days of yore, part 1
  • Part II: Spome, spome on the range : where will humans live off-world?. The moon : great location, bit of a fixer-upper ; Mars : landscapes of poison and toxic skies, but what an opportunity! ; Giant rotating space wheels : not literally the worst option ; Worse options ; Nota bene : space is the place for product placement, or, space capitalism in days of yore, part 2
  • Part III: Pocket Edens : how to create a human terrarium that isn't all that terrible. Outputs and inputs : poop, food, and "closing the loop" ; There's no place like spome : how to build outer-space habitats ; Nota bene : the mystery of the tampon bandolier
  • Part IV: Space law for space settlements : weird, vague, and hard to change. A cynical history of space ; The outer space treaty : great for regulating space sixty years ago ; Murder in space : who killed the moon agreement? ; Nota bene : space cannibalism from a legal and culinary perspective
  • Part V: The paths forward : bound for Moonsylvania?. Commonsing the cosmos ; Dividing the sky ; The birth of space-states : like the birth of space babies, but messier ; Nota bene : violence in Antarctica, or, happy endings to stabby starts
  • Part VI: To plan B or not to plan B : space society, expansion, and existential risk. There's no labor pool on Mars : outer space as a company town ; How big is big? : plan B settlements without genetic or economic calamities ; Space politics by other means : on the possibility of space war ; A brief coda on a rarely considered alternative : wait-and-go-nowhere ; Nota bene : amusing astronaut names and the Soviet tendency to fuss over weird details
  • Conclusion : of hot tubs and human destiny.
